1. Lemon Herb Marinade

The Lemon Herb Marinade is a bright, fresflying poultry h option that’s perfect for summer grilling or a light roast. The acidity from the lemon tenderizes the chicken, while fresh herbs add a burst of flavor.

Ingredients:

  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• Juice of 2 lemons
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h rosemary,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on fresh thyme, chopped
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ions:

  1. Wh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, rosemary, thyme, salt, and pepper.
  2. Place the chicken in a resealable bag and pour the marinade over it.
  3. Marinate in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es, or up to 4 hours for more flavor.

Best Cooking Methods:

Grill or roast the marinated chicken. Lemon Herb Chicken pairs wonderfully with roasted vegetables or a fresh side salad.


2. Soy Honey Garlic Marinade

This Soy Honey Garlic Marinade brings together sweet, savory, and umami flavors, making it a hit with both kids and adults. The honey caramelizes beautifully during cooking, giving the chicken a golden glaze.

Ingredients:

  • 1/4 cup soy sauce
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on rice v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on fresh ginger, grated (optional)
  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il

Instructions:

  1. In a bowl, mix soy sauce, honey, garlic, rice vinegar, ginger, and sesame oil.
  2. Pour the marinade over the chicken in a resealable bag and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, or overnight for deeper flavor.

Best Cooking Methods:

Grill, bake, or stir-fry. This marinade is perfect for chicken thighs, which stay juicy and flavorful with the glaze. Serve with steamed rice and sautéed vegetables for a complete meal.


3. Greek Yogurt and Mint Marinade

This Greek Yogurt and Mint Marinade is ideal for keeping chicken tender and juicy. The yogurt tenderizes the meat while the mint adds a refreshing twist, making this marinade perfect for hot days or family gatherings.

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up Greek yogurt
  • Juice of 1 lemon
  • 2 tablespoons fresh mint,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on fresh dill,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ions:

  1. Combine Greek yogurt, lemon juice, mint, dill, garlic, salt, and pepper in a bowl.
  2. Coat the chicken with the yogurt mixture, cover, and refrigerate for 2-4 hours.

Best Cooking Methods:

Grill or bake the chicken until golden brown. This marinade is ideal for chicken skewers or kabobs, served with pita bread, hummus, and a side salad.


4. Spicy Cajun Marinade

For families who enjoy a little heat, the Spicy Cajun Marinade is a must-try. This marinade is packed with bold spices that give the chicken a smoky, spicy kick. Adjust the spice level to suit your family’s preferences!

Ingredients:

  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on Cajun seasoning
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per (optional, for extra heat)
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ions:

  1. Mix olive oil, Cajun seasoning, smoked paprika, cayenne pepper, garlic, salt, and pepper in a bowl.
  2. Place the chicken in a resealable bag, add the marinade, and refrigerate for 1-2 hours.

Best Cooking Methods:

Grill or pan-sear the chicken for a spicy, flavorful meal. This marinade works particularly well with chicken wings or drumsticks and pairs great with coleslaw or corn on the cob.


5. Honey Mustard Marinade

The Honey Mustard Marinade is a classic combination that adds a tangy, sweet flavor to the chicken. The mustard tenderizes the meat, while the honey balances out the sharpness with a touch of sweetness.

Ingredients:

  • 1/4 cup Dijon mustard
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ions:

  1. Whisk together Dijon mustard, honey, olive oil, apple cider vinegar, salt, and pepper.
  2. Add the marinade to the chicken and let it marinate in the refrigerator for at least 1 hour.

Best Cooking Methods:

Bake or grill the chicken. Honey mustard chicken is perfect for salads, sandwiches, or alongside roasted potatoes and green beans.


Tips for Marinating Chicken

To get the most out of these marinades, follow these simple tips for the best results:

  1. Use Fresh, High-Quality Chicken: Start with fresh chicken from Flying Poultry for optimal flavor and tenderness.
  2. Marinate in the Refrigerator: Always marinate chicken in the fridge, not at room temperature, to avoid bacteria growth.
  3. Timing is Key: While most marinades work well with 30 minutes to 4 hours of marinating, chicken can also benefit from overnight marinating, especially for tougher cuts like thighs and drumsticks.
  4. Use Airtight Bags: Resealable bags are ideal for marinating as they allow the chicken to be evenly coated and make cleanup easy.
  5. Don’t Reuse Marinades: Avoid reusing marinades as they can carry bacteria from raw chicken. If you want extra sauce, set aside a portion before marinating.
